Agyemang scores crucial goal as Derby edge Blackburn in EFL Championship thriller

Patrick Agyemang’s first-half header proved decisive as Derby County secured a 2-1 win over Blackburn Rovers at Ewood Park in the Championship.

The American-Ghanaian striker powered home Joe Ward’s cross just before halftime, doubling Derby’s lead after Carlton Morris had opened the scoring with a header from Callum Elder’s corner in the 19th minute.

Agyemang’s goal his latest in an impressive run embodied hunger and precision, earning cheers from the travelling Derby fans before he was substituted in the 71st minute after a tireless display.

Despite Yuki Ohashi pulling one back for Blackburn in the 66th minute, Derby’s disciplined defence held firm to seal an important away victory.
